Hello,
We are installing a new 3cx system, latest stable v16 and extensions should be able to dial *31*[PSTN_number] in order to hide their caller ID.
So the call should reach the SIP provider (SIP Trunk with 3cx) with a RURI user = *31*XXXXXXXXXX

i have crated an outbound rule as follows:
Calls to numbers starting with prefix = *31*
Send to: VoIP Provider

simple as that.
However, based on the 3cx logs, 3cx does not actually use this outbound rule and only looks as the first digits, i.e. *3, which is the default FAC to change an extension status.
What is the way to send calls to the provider by prepending the *31* ?

Hi @George Ts ,

So you have a case of overlapping dial-codes.
What you must do is go to Settings --> Dial Codes, and here change the existing "Change Profile Status" as that is intercepting the dialed number.

Change it to something unused like: *8
